What Is A Cordless Electric Screwdriver?
A cordless electric screwdriver is a rechargeable fastening tool designed to drive and remove screws without requiring a power cord.
Unlike heavy-duty power drills, cordless electric screwdrivers focus on controlled torque and precision operation.
Typical features include:
- Rechargeable lithium battery
- Compact body design
- Multiple precision bits
- USB-C charging
- Forward and reverse operation
- Low-noise performance
These features make cordless electric screwdrivers ideal for electronics repair, precision assembly, and maintenance work.

Engineering Principles Behind Better Performance
Torque Control
Recommended torque ranges:
| Application | Recommended Torque |
|---|---|
| Smartphone Repair | 0.2–0.35 N·m |
| Laptop Repair | 0.3–0.5 N·m |
| PCB Assembly | 0.2–0.4 N·m |
| Camera Repair | 0.2–0.35 N·m |
Using the correct torque helps prevent stripped screws and damaged housings.
